This trope is a popular way to explore characters' emotional depths. It allows fans to depict their journey from enemies (or rivals) to lovers, often through a series of charged encounters, misunderstandings, and emotional breakthroughs. This transition from a combative to an affectionate relationship makes for deeply compelling and dramatic storytelling. It’s a journey many fans feel is a logical extension of their relationship in the series, where they are often depicted as understanding each other better than anyone else.
: Fans often interpret their intense canon obsession—manifested in Naruto's years-long quest to "bring Sasuke home"—as having romantic undercurrents.
